How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Summit?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Summit 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,466 | $1,300 | $1,600 |
| Summit 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,802 | $1,500 | $3,294 |
| Summit 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,300 | $2,300 | $2,300 |
| Summit 4 Bedroom Apartments | $12,453 | $10,000 | $10,000+ |

What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Summit c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Summit range from $1,500 to $3,294.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,802.
